Join Grit Music for The Longest Day, a family friendly folk music event to celebrate the summer solstice. We'll be gathering outside, by the woods, with three local folk acts brought to us on a solar-powered sound system.

Artist info

Hevelwood takes folk stories both ancient and new and overlays them with digital fuzz and uncertainty. A Leeds-based producer working with traditional song, he has released 2 EPs of folk song interpretations and his debut LP Of Greatness Receding was released in Autumn 2023. Hevelwood's live sets develop the lore further, leaning into the intimacy and immediacy of a stripped back acoustic set from the raw power of a cappella ballads to richly layered vocal harmonies.

Kairos are Kasia Sikora Black and Rosie Hayes, who met whilst unlearning all of their formal training to become music therapists. Years later - having developed a deep friendship and accumulated many an evening spent tinkering with harmonies and exploring the magic of two voices stitched together - they are putting out their fledgling set of new takes on some of their favourite tunes, with a folky/eclectic spin. Mike Chater is based in Shipley a stones throw from Northcliffe. Over the last few years he's recorded an eclectic mix of music in his spare room and played intimate gigs in and around Bradford. Expect finger style folk and bluesy guitar playing with introspective lyrics and a versatile singing style.
